The Canopy Problem: Sap, Pollen & Leaf Litter
In our experience, the mature tree canopy shading the larger plots of Cleveland Lodge and the older corners of Eaglescliffe Village is the single biggest drag on solar output anywhere in town. Sycamore and lime trees weep a sticky sap through late spring that solar glass grips onto almost like flypaper, and by autumn that same canopy is dropping a leaf litter and pollen load that works its way into every gap between cell and frame. A handful of warm days is all it takes to bake that organic film into a translucent, light-scattering skin that ordinary rainfall cannot touch.

Avian Fouling Near the River Tees
Low Eaglescliffe's position on the riverbank, and the open farmland fringing Urlay Nook, put local arrays directly in the flight path of heavy bird traffic - wood pigeon, gulls following the river upstream, and garden birds drawn in by the mature planting further inland. Droppings are intensely acidic and completely opaque: a single deposit blocks all light to the cell beneath it, and left in place long enough, the uric acid etches the glass surface itself, leaving a mark that no later cleaning can fully lift.

Molecular Hunger
Strip water of its natural minerals - calcium, magnesium, potassium - and it becomes chemically restless, constantly seeking a balanced state again. That restlessness is exactly what we put to work on your panels: the water binds molecularly to sap residue, road film from Yarm Road, and baked-on bird lime, lifting each of them away through simple chemical attraction rather than force.
Zero-Residue Evaporation
Mains water across Eaglescliffe and the wider TS16 area runs hard, carrying a significant load of dissolved minerals. Splash ordinary tap water onto a sun-warmed panel and those minerals stay behind as it dries, crystallising into white calcified spots that act as tiny, disruptive lenses scattering light away from the cells underneath. Water purified to 000 PPM has nothing left to leave behind.
Protecting the Hydrophobic Layer
Most modern Tier 1 solar panels arrive from the factory with a delicate hydrophobic, self-cleaning coating already applied. Off-the-shelf degreasers, household soaps, or anything marketed as a general "solar cleaner" will strip that layer away within a handful of washes. Our pure-water method carries no surfactants or chemicals whatsoever, so the manufacturer's original surface treatment is left completely undisturbed.
The Science of Yield Restoration
Solar cells depend on direct, completely unobstructed ultraviolet penetration to perform. When tree sap, leaf litter and road film bake onto the toughened glass over a TS16 roof, that penetration is physically throttled - a process the industry calls "soiling." Plenty of homeowners in Eaglescliffe assume that a riverside setting, and no shortage of Teesside rain, keeps an array clean by default.
It doesn't. Rainwater is never entirely pure - as it falls it collects its own microscopic atmospheric pollutants and dust, and when it evaporates on a warm panel it leaves a faint, muddy film behind. Under the canopy shading much of Low Eaglescliffe and Cleveland Lodge, that residue mixes with genuine sap and pollen fallout, and over a typical 12 to 24-month period it thickens into a permanent, light-blocking layer that routine rain simply cannot shift.
Bringing in a professional solar panel cleaner isn't only about how the array looks from Eaglescliffe Village or the street below - it's a technical intervention that keeps the inverter's internal logic running at its peak efficiency curve. Even a small patch of shading from debris pooled in one corner of a single panel can trigger the system's "bypass diodes," causing an immediate, disproportionate drop in generation across the whole string.
Protecting the AR Coating
Modern photovoltaic modules carry a highly sensitive Anti-Reflective (AR) coating engineered to capture more light during low-angle periods such as sunrise and sunset - exactly when a low winter sun is filtering in under the tree line along the river. Standard detergents or generic chemical cleaners degrade this coating over time, causing a permanent loss of yield. Our process uses strictly zero chemicals, relying entirely on the natural solvency of deionised water.
Our 4-Step Technical Process
A domestic or commercial solar array is a live, high-voltage electrical generation system, capable of several hundred volts of direct current. On the riverside and tree-lined plots around Eaglescliffe, that demands exactly the same uncompromising safety protocols whether we're working twenty feet from the water at Low Eaglescliffe or beneath a mature canopy in Cleveland Lodge.
Ground-Level Thermal Assessment
Before a single drop of purified water touches your roof, we carry out a full visual and optical survey from ground level using high-reach assessment equipment, checking for any pre-existing sign of physical or thermal damage - "snail trails" that indicate an internal cell has already begun to fail, for instance.
Recording this baseline first means we deploy exactly the right washing method for your specific array configuration, whether that's a modest bungalow roof near Urlay Nook or a large multi-string system on a riverside property in Low Eaglescliffe, protecting against water ingress and electrical short circuits either way.
Pure Water Saturation & Pre-Soak
Lichen, moss and heavy biological matter thrive in the microscopic gaps between glass and frame - a particularly common issue on the larger, tree-shadowed plots around Cleveland Lodge and the older parts of Eaglescliffe Village. We apply a low-pressure, high-volume mist of pure deionised water to fully saturate this baked-on biomass before we touch it.
We never use high-pressure washers: a jet wash can force its way past the fragile rubber and silicone waterproof seals in seconds. Our gentle soaking mist rehydrates and softens the grip of baked-on grime and corrosive bird lime instead, preparing it for safe, frictionless removal.
Precision Brush Agitation
Once the debris has softened, we work each panel individually with specialised solar brushes fitted with soft-flocked, non-scratch bristles. Technicians are trained never to lean weight into the glass or apply anything beyond the lightest agitating pressure.
Particular attention goes to the bottom edge of the aluminium frame, where dirt and algae collect to form a biological "dam". Clearing that blockage lets rainwater drain freely afterwards, rather than pooling and creating the conditions for a hot-spot to develop.
The Final Zero-Residue Rinse
The process finishes with a heavy, high-flow rinse of 100% pure deionised water calibrated to exactly 000 PPM. At that purity, the water behaves like a liquid magnet for any last microscopic particle, flushing it away completely.
Panels are left "surgically clean" - genuinely streak-free, with zero calcium spotting - so the glass reaches its maximum transparency, ready to capture every available photon of Eaglescliffe sunlight, river mist or not.

Protecting Your Warranty.
Manufacturer maintenance guidelines are strict and unforgiving. Using standard window-cleaning chemicals, a pressure washer, or simply walking across the modules to reach a shaded corner under the canopy can permanently void your warranty.
Zero-Pressure Cleaning
We never use pressure washers. High-pressure water forces its way past the delicate waterproof seals, causing internal corrosion and irreparable short circuits. Our low-pressure, pure-water delivery system is fully compliant with major Tier 1 manufacturer standards.
Telescopic Ground-Access
We work almost entirely from the ground, using rigid telescopic carbon-fibre poles capable of reaching the tallest riverside rooflines around Low Eaglescliffe. No human weight is ever placed on your roof tiles or the modules themselves, which rules out the invisible micro-cracking that foot traffic causes.
Deionised & Solvent-Free
We use zero detergents, degreasers or standard soaps. Most household cleaning agents leave a microscopic sticky residue that attracts more dust and pollen than it removes. Our deionised water is the purest natural solvent available, so your AR coating stays completely intact.
Avoid "Panel Walking"
Some providers walk on panels to reach the centre of an array. Even if the glass doesn't crack, the weight creates "Micro-Cracks" in the internal silicon cells, resulting in immediate efficiency loss and a permanent fire hazard. Operation Clean operates 100% from the ground.
